WebComplete System Cleaning. Recommended every two weeks to effectively prevent yeast and bacteria buildup. Lines are flushed with a brewery-approved cleaner, rinsed, and repacked with beer. Acid Wash. Recommended every three months to break down beer stone. An acid wash is flushed through the system. WebMay 13, 2014 · Clean beer lines and beer-clean glasses have fewer nucleation sites and therefore keep the carbon dioxide dissolved in the beer, where it belongs. ... The proper level of carbonation, in addition to its sensory augmentation of a beer, is critical to a good pour. Brewers measure carbonation as volumes of carbon dioxide.
